عنوان انگلیسی مقاله ISI
Dispersion of iron nano-particles on expanded graphite for the shielding of electromagnetic radiation

چکیده انگلیسی
Composite materials containing electrically conductive expanded graphite (EG) and magnetic iron nano-particles for electromagnetic shielding were prepared by impregnating EG with an ethanol solution containing iron nitrate and acetic acid, followed by drying and reduction in H2. Magnetic nano-iron particles were found to be highly dispersed on the surface of EG in the Fe/EG composites, and played the role of enhancing the electromagnetic shielding effectiveness (SE) at low frequencies (0.3–10 MHz), which seemed to depend proportionally on magnetic hysteresis loss of loaded iron nano-particles.
